How they compare
Turkmenistan currently reports 116,195 against 114,205 in Kyrgyzstan, a difference of 1,990.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 25 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Kyrgyzstan ahead.
Kyrgyzstan ranks 102nd and Turkmenistan ranks 101st of 191 countries.
Kyrgyzstan has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
